Вопросы к Поиску с Алисой

Примеры ответов Поиска с Алисой
Главная / Наука и образование / В чем разница между классической и новой моделью создания pull request в Git?
Вопрос для Поиска с Алисой
24 апреля

В чем разница между классической и новой моделью создания pull request в Git?

Алиса
На основе источников, возможны неточности

Возможно, имелись в виду модели совместной разработки в Git, среди которых есть варианты создания pull-запросов. blog.mergify.com habr.com Некоторые из них:

  • Модель «Fork + Pull». codex.so habr.com Позволяет любому склонировать существующий репозиторий и сливать изменения в свой личный fork без необходимости иметь доступ к оригинальному репозиторию. habr.com Затем изменения должны быть включены в исходный репозиторий его хозяином. habr.com Эта модель популярна для open source проектов, так как позволяет людям работать независимо, без единого координирования. habr.com
  • Модель «общего репозитория» (The Shared Repository Model). habr.com Чаще встречается у малых команд и организаций, работающих над закрытыми проектами. habr.com Каждый в команде имеет доступ «на запись» в один общий репозиторий, а для изолирования изменений применяются тематические ветви (topic branches). habr.com

Pull-запросы полезны в обеих моделях. habr.com В модели «Fork + Pull» они предоставляют способ уведомить хозяина оригинального репозитория об изменениях в копии репозитория. habr.com В модели общего репозитория они обычно используются для того, чтобы инициировать пересмотр или обсуждение кода перед тем, как включать его в основную ветвь разработки. habr.com

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Алисой
Войдите, чтобы поставить лайк
С Яндекс ID это займёт пару секунд
Войти
Tue Aug 26 2025 09:00:20 GMT+0300 (Moscow Standard Time)